What is a Chicken and Seafood Diet?

4 min read
According to Healthline, individuals who eat both poultry and fish but no other meats are technically known as pesce-pollotarians, a variation of semi-vegetarianism. This eating pattern, often called a chicken and seafood diet, combines the protein of lean poultry with the omega-3s of fish for a nutrient-rich menu.

What Do You Call a Partial Vegetarian? Understanding the Terms

4 min read
According to a 2020 Gallup poll, nearly one in four Americans have cut back on eating meat over the past year. If you are wondering what to call a partial vegetarian, the most common terms are 'flexitarian' or 'semi-vegetarian,' which describe someone who primarily eats a plant-based diet but occasionally includes meat or fish. This dietary pattern has become increasingly popular due to its health, environmental, and ethical benefits.
